2 hours ago, Goku1814 said:

Ik that sli is dead with modern cards. But could u technically go back a card like the 1080ti which is fairly cheap and get 2 in sli and be able to play modern games at high settings? I'm just curious that's all.

To further clarify: a game REQUIRES compatibility with SLI to be built into during development for SLI to work.

 

No recent games in the last 5 or so years have had any SLI functionality, so even if you had a working setup, you’d still only utilize one gpu on any modern game.
